Georgina
Macdonald
Gina Macdonald is the President of Morgan Group LLC. At Morgan, she has consulted for a variety
of clients, and stepped in to special situations as an interim
executive. Currently Gina is CEO of Estateworks, a provider of
web-based esdatte planning and settlement software.
During 2000 and 2001, Gina was Chairman and
CEO of geoVue, a software company based in Boston.
At geoVue, she took a stalled company into new strategic
directions, raised their first round of venture financing, and
built a management team and product structure.
Prior to joining Morgan, Gina was an executive
at Fleet/Boston Financial Group where, among other assignments,
she was President and CEO of Fleet Real Estate Capital, and Senior
Vice President and Director of Corporate Marketing for Fleet Insurance
Services.
As CEO of Fleet Real Estate Capital, she built
a company focused oncommercial real estate loan originations,
loan servicing, special servicing of distressed loans and asset
management for institutional investors across the country, with
a special emphasis on securitized loans. During her tenure, the servicing portfolio
grew from $400 million to more than $4.2 billion, and under her
leadership, the bottom line was turned around from a loss to a
significant profit. Fleet Real Estate Capital had 11 offices in
nine states and grew from 20 employees to more than 150 employees
in 2 ˝ years.
Prior to Fleet Real Estate Capital, Gina was
Senior Vice President and head of RECOLL Management Corporation’s
Owned Real Estate (ORE). At RECOLL, Gina recruited and ran a group to manage
and sell a $2 Billion portfolio of Commercial Real Estate.
From 1986 to 1991, Ms. Macdonald was President
of The Meridian Group, a privately held real estate investment
company. She was a Senior
Vice President and group manager in the Commercial Real Estate
department of Fleet Bank from 1981 to 1986.
From 1977 through 1981, she was Director of Corporate Communications/Investor
Relations for Fleet Financial Group.
Ms. Macdonald, who majored in history at Indiana
University, is a board member of the Massachusetts Women’s Forum,
First Trade Union Bank, Indiana Warehouses and Crosley Building
Corporation, a Corporation member of the Providence Public Library,
and was a founding member of the Steering Committee of New England
Women in Real Estate (NEWIRE). She is an avid sailor, gardener and skier.
